this is lottie's take on pillsbury funfetti cake

3 eggs whisked with 8oz sugar until pale in colour and double in size...melt 4oz butter and slowly pour into mix whilst whisking.....whisk in vanilla and 8oz sr flour...bake 180c 40mins

allow to cool then slice cake in half

melt a whole bag of marshmallows and use to sandwich cake halves together and cover top

italian meringues

the girls love this bbc series and i found the new book at the library

so we made this and ate it with the biggest raspberries we've ever seen (co-op half price at the mo...£2 a punnet and very lovely indeed)

italian meringues differ from english because you add hot sugar syrup whilst whisking egg whites, they don't need long to cook (we just whacked ours in the oven after we'd cooked dinner and turned the heat off and left for 20mins)...produces a fluffier (less cardboardy) meringue
